What's Reasonable to Expect from the Tracking Service?

You know what? It’s actually pretty common for customers to think that USPS should automatically inform them of delays without being prompted. However, while being kept in the loop sounds ideal, the bigger expectation revolves around your understanding of that tracking number you’ve received.

Key Expectations When Using the Tracking Service

Now, let’s clarify what you can realistically expect:

  • Guidance on Usage: You should know how to enter your tracking number to view status updates. If you're not sure how this works, a quick visit to the USPS website's tracking information section can clear things up.

  • Real-Time Updates: Once your number is submitted, you're typically given real-time updates about your shipment's journey. This is a major part of the service.

  • Responsibility of the Customer: Yes, it’s your responsibility to keep an eye on the tracking updates. Remember, once you have that tracking number, you're embarking on your treasure hunt to find out when your package will arrive.

What About the Other Options?

Let’s briefly touch on those other expectations which, while valid, aren’t the core of the tracking service.

  • New Tracking Numbers: If your package is really lost in the Bermuda Triangle, USPS may provide a new tracking number. However, that’s more about handling errors than an everyday expectation.

  • Refunds for Unmet Delivery Times: Many people believe they deserve refunds for delays, which makes sense since waiting isn’t fun. But in reality, refunds due to delays aren’t a standard practice. It’s always best to check their policies for specifics.
